The Role The Restaurant is set within our Audley Retirement village, the village has its own health club, library, fine dining restaurant, bar and luxury suites. Audley villages comprises of owners, who permanently reside on site within their own private homes but also hosts external customers. From the simple to the finest cuisine, beautiful settings in heritage buildings and, of course, the very best people. As a growing luxury brand, we’re serious about investing in our people’s training and development, making this a great place to build on your skills, take on a varied range of roles and develop your career in hospitality in double quick time. As our Restaurant Supervisor you will be an integral part in the smooth running of Audley villages and you’ll supervise the team to ensure that Audley Owners and External Customers have the highest quality of service and experience. You will ensure the team adhere to legislative requirements such as COSHH, Fire safety, Health & Safety and Safeguarding of our owners. You will maintain high standards of comfort, cleanliness and hygiene throughout the bistro, restaurant and customer areas. You will set and maintain the highest standards of dress appearance and be equipped to deal with sudden employee shortages being able to deputise in any job capacity. Deal with complaints in a warm and empathetic way, as necessary. The Ideal Candidate: Food and beverage management experience in a 4* or higher hospitality environment. Knowledge of cash handling procedures, stock, wastage and par level control, rotas and unexpected situations.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al. Self-motivated and driven by standards and sales opportunities. Excellent organisation skills with the ability to prioritise and produce creative solutions. Hands on and flexible approach in order to be able to carry out a variety of tasks to the need of the village. How to prepare for a job interview at Audley Villages

✨Know the Venue Inside Out

Before your interview, take some time to research Audley Retirement village. Familiarise yourself with their dining options, services, and overall atmosphere. This will not only show your genuine interest but also help you answer questions more effectively.

✨Showcase Your Leadership Skills

As a Restaurant Supervisor, you'll be leading a team. Prepare examples of how you've successfully managed teams in the past, dealt with complaints, or handled unexpected situations.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your responses.

✨Emphasise Your Attention to Detail

In hospitality, the little things matter. Be ready to discuss how you maintain high standards of cleanliness, hygiene, and customer service. Share specific instances where your attention to detail made a difference in a guest's experience.

✨Prepare Questions for Them

Interviews are a two-way street! Prepare thoughtful questions about the team dynamics, training opportunities, or how they handle busy periods. This shows you're not just interested in the role, but also in how you can contribute to their success.
